freebsd는 리눅스 시스템인가요?
freebsd는 Linux 시스템이 아니지만 BSD, 386BSD 및 4.4BSD를 통해 개발된 UNIX와 유사한 운영 체제입니다. FreeBSD는 다양한 아키텍처의 컴퓨터 시스템에 대해 다양한 수준의 지원을 제공합니다.
이 튜토리얼의 운영 환경: freebsd13.1 시스템, Dell G3 컴퓨터.
freebsd는 리눅스 시스템인가요?
아니요.
FreeBSD는 UNIX와 유사한 운영 체제로 BSD, 386BSD 및 4.4BSD를 통해 개발된 Unix의 중요한 분기입니다. FreeBSD는 다양한 아키텍처의 컴퓨터 시스템에 대해 다양한 수준의 지원을 제공합니다. 그리고 원래 BSD UNIX 개발자 중 일부는 나중에 FreeBSD 개발로 전환하여 FreeBSD가 내부 구조 및 시스템 API 측면에서 UNIX와 매우 호환되도록 만들었습니다. FreeBSD의 느슨한 법적 조건으로 인해 해당 코드는 Apple의 macOS를 포함한 다른 많은 시스템에서 차용되었습니다. macOS가 UNIX 상표 인증을 획득한 것은 바로 macOS의 UNIX 호환성 때문입니다.
FreeBSD는 amd64(x86_64), X86(i386), ARM, AArch64, IA-64, PowerPC, PC-98, SPARC 및 기타 아키텍처를 지원합니다(버전마다 지원이 다름)(자세한 내용은 공식 문서 참조).
개발 역사
FreeBSD의 개발은 1993년 386BSD에서 시작되었습니다. 그러나 386BSD 소스 코드의 적법성이 의심되고 Novell(당시 UNIX의 저작권 보유자)과 Berkeley가 잇따라 소송을 제기했기 때문에 FreeBSD는 1995년 1월 캘리포니아 대학의 4.4BSD-Lite 릴리스로 2.0-RELEASE를 출시했습니다. 완전히 다시 작성되었습니다. FreeBSD 매뉴얼에는 FreeBSD에 대한 더 많은 역사가 있습니다.
FreeBSD 2.0의 가장 주목할만한 측면은 아마도 Carnegie Mellon University의 Mach 가상 메모리 시스템에 대한 정밀 검사와 FreeBSD 포트 시스템의 발명일 것입니다. 전자는 고부하 시스템에 최적화된 반면, 후자는 타사 소프트웨어를 유지 관리하기 위한 간단하고 강력한 메커니즘을 구축합니다. 많은 대규모 사이트가 FreeBSD를 사용하지만 많은 회사가 Linux 플랫폼으로 전환하고 있으며 많은 VPS(가상 개인 호스트)도 FreeBSD 공간을 제공합니다.
FreeBSD 3.0은 ELF 바이너리 형식을 도입하고 다중 CPU 시스템(SMP, Symmetric multiprocessing) 및 64비트 Alpha 플랫폼을 지원하기 시작했습니다. 3.x는 시스템에 많은 개혁을 가했지만, 이러한 조치는 당시에는 이점을 가져오지 못했지만 4.X 성공의 초석이 되었습니다.
참고: UNIX는 다중 사용자 및 멀티 태스킹 운영 체제인 반면 Linux는 UNIX 기반 운영 체제입니다.
관련 추천: "Linux 비디오 튜토리얼"
위 내용은 freebsd는 리눅스 시스템인가요?의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

핫 AI 도구

Undresser.AI Undress
사실적인 누드 사진을 만들기 위한 AI 기반 앱

AI Clothes Remover
사진에서 옷을 제거하는 온라인 AI 도구입니다.

Undress AI Tool
무료로 이미지를 벗다

Clothoff.io
AI 옷 제거제

AI Hentai Generator
AI Hentai를 무료로 생성하십시오.

인기 기사

뜨거운 도구

메모장++7.3.1
사용하기 쉬운 무료 코드 편집기

SublimeText3 중국어 버전
중국어 버전, 사용하기 매우 쉽습니다.

스튜디오 13.0.1 보내기
강력한 PHP 통합 개발 환경

드림위버 CS6
시각적 웹 개발 도구

SublimeText3 Mac 버전
신 수준의 코드 편집 소프트웨어(SublimeText3)

뜨거운 주제











Apache를 시작하는 단계는 다음과 같습니다. Apache 설치 (명령 : Sudo apt-get Apache2를 설치하거나 공식 웹 사이트에서 다운로드) 시작 apache (linux : sudo systemctl start : windes (선택 사항, Linux : Sudo SystemCtl

Apache 80 포트가 점유되면 솔루션은 다음과 같습니다. 포트를 차지하고 닫는 프로세스를 찾으십시오. 방화벽 설정을 확인하여 Apache가 차단되지 않았는지 확인하십시오. 위의 방법이 작동하지 않으면 Apache를 재구성하여 다른 포트를 사용하십시오. Apache 서비스를 다시 시작하십시오.

Apache 서버를 다시 시작하려면 다음 단계를 따르십시오. Linux/MacOS : Sudo SystemCTL 실행 Apache2를 다시 시작하십시오. Windows : Net Stop Apache2.4를 실행 한 다음 Net Start Apache2.4를 시작하십시오. Netstat -A |를 실행하십시오 서버 상태를 확인하려면 Findstr 80.

다음과 같은 이유로 Apache가 시작할 수 없습니다. 구성 파일 구문 오류. 다른 응용 프로그램 포트와 충돌합니다. 권한 문제. 기억이 없습니다. 프로세스 교착 상태. 데몬 실패. Selinux 권한 문제. 방화벽 문제. 소프트웨어 충돌.

이 안내서는 데비안 시스템에서 syslog를 사용하는 방법을 배우도록 안내합니다. Syslog는 로깅 시스템 및 응용 프로그램 로그 메시지를위한 Linux 시스템의 핵심 서비스입니다. 관리자가 시스템 활동을 모니터링하고 분석하여 문제를 신속하게 식별하고 해결하는 데 도움이됩니다. 1. syslog에 대한 기본 지식 syslog의 핵심 기능에는 다음이 포함됩니다. 로그 메시지 중앙 수집 및 관리; 다중 로그 출력 형식 및 대상 위치 (예 : 파일 또는 네트워크) 지원; 실시간 로그보기 및 필터링 기능 제공. 2. Syslog 설치 및 구성 (RSYSLOG 사용) Debian 시스템은 기본적으로 RSYSLOG를 사용합니다. 다음 명령으로 설치할 수 있습니다 : sudoaptupdatesud

인터넷은 단일 운영 체제에 의존하지 않지만 Linux는 이에 중요한 역할을합니다. Linux는 서버 및 네트워크 장치에서 널리 사용되며 안정성, 보안 및 확장 성으로 인기가 있습니다.

Apache 취약점을 수정하는 단계는 다음과 같습니다. 1. 영향을받는 버전을 결정합니다. 2. 보안 업데이트를 적용합니다. 3. Apache를 다시 시작하십시오. 4. 수정을 확인하십시오. 5. 보안 기능을 활성화합니다.

Nginx 서버를 시작하려면 다른 운영 체제에 따라 다른 단계가 필요합니다. Linux/Unix System : Nginx 패키지 설치 (예 : APT-Get 또는 Yum 사용). SystemCTL을 사용하여 nginx 서비스를 시작하십시오 (예 : Sudo SystemCtl start nginx). Windows 시스템 : Windows 바이너리 파일을 다운로드하여 설치합니다. nginx.exe 실행 파일을 사용하여 nginx를 시작하십시오 (예 : nginx.exe -c conf \ nginx.conf). 어떤 운영 체제를 사용하든 서버 IP에 액세스 할 수 있습니다.
